Nottingham Girl Geek Dinners are an opportunity for like-minded women to talk about technology over food and drinks. The events are aimed at providing a welcoming atmosphere and a platform for learning in an informal environment. They are usually held in local bars or restaurants, with a speaker who talks for a short while on a chosen subject for the evening.

The speaker for the evening in Susi O'Neill who provides digital media consultancy, specialising in product innovation, organisation development, skills, and digital marketing for commercial companies and business support organisations. She has worked with clients including Universal Music and East Midlands Development Agency. She also describes herself as an avant-garde musician and thereminist.
